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
RealityScan
- The free tier is bounded by company revenue rather than by usage, so a business crossing one million US dollars of turnover acquires a per-seat cost overnight for software its workflow now depends on
- New perpetual licences are no longer sold, so an organisation that deliberately avoided subscription software has no route in; existing perpetual holders keep their version but stop receiving updates unless they accept the current terms
- It is Windows only and needs an NVIDIA CUDA capable GPU, which excludes macOS studios and makes the real cost of adoption a workstation purchase rather than a licence
- The rename from RealityCapture to RealityScan in 2025 means tutorials, forum answers and third party pipeline documentation are split across two names and several licensing regimes, and much of it is now wrong about price
- The interface assumes photogrammetry knowledge; alignment failures, control point placement and reconstruction region setup are not guided, so a team without an experienced operator produces poor models quickly rather than good ones slowly
Tinkercad
- Limited to simple block-based modeling, unsuitable for complex or precise mechanical CAD work.
- Lacks advanced surfacing, parametric assembly, and simulation tools found in professional CAD software like Fusion 360.
- Requires an internet connection since it runs entirely in the browser with no offline desktop app.
- Export and rendering options are basic compared to dedicated 3D modeling or CAD applications.
Pricing, plan by plan
RealityScan
Free- Free tierFree
- For individuals and companies with annual revenue under 1,000,000 USD
- Full application, no metered input charges
- Epic account required
- RealityScan seat$1250/year
- Required once annual revenue exceeds 1,000,000 USD
- Per seat, per year
- Commercial use without output restrictions
- Unreal Engine subscription$1850/year
- Per seat per year
- Includes RealityScan and Twinmotion
- For teams that also need Unreal Engine for non-game commercial use

Answered from the vendors’ own pages
RealityScan: Is RealityCapture still called that?
No. Epic rebranded it to RealityScan with version 2.0 in 2025. It is the same engine and the same team.
RealityScan: Who gets it free?
Individuals and companies with annual revenue under one million US dollars. Above that, a seat is 1,250 US dollars per year.
RealityScan: Can I still buy a perpetual licence?
Not for new purchases. Existing perpetual licences remain valid for the version owned, with updates only under the current terms.
RealityScan: Does the free version restrict output?
No output metering or watermarking; the restriction is on who qualifies, based on company revenue, not on what you export.
